随笔分类 - B. OI时代
摘要:Description 在市场上有很多商品的定价类似于 999 元、4999 元、8999 元这样。它们和 1000 元、5000 元和 9000 元并没有什么本质区别,但是在心理学上会让人感觉便宜很多,因此也是商家常用的价格策略。不过在你看来,这种价格十分荒谬。于是你如此计算一个价格 p(p 为正
阅读全文
摘要:1、前言 NOIP前互测题第一弹——来自hcy的贪心专题。因为我考试前一天晚上手贱(真的算手贱吗)去BZOJ上刷题然后碰巧那道题就是今天的考试题,结果碰巧又被hcy注意到了。。。其实本来我无意去知道的。。结果就这样莫名其妙地A了。贪心什么的感觉还好,另外一道题以前做过,对于“三分”这个概念我印象还很
阅读全文
摘要:Description 很久很久之前,森林里住着一群兔子。有一天,兔子们突然决定要去看樱花。兔子们所在森林里的樱花树很特殊。樱花树由n个树枝分叉点组成,编号从0到n-1,这n个分叉点由n-1个树枝连接,我们可以把它看成一个有根树结构,其中0号节点是根节点。这个树的每个节点上都会有一些樱花,其中第i个
阅读全文
摘要:1、前言 又是绿书上的题目。这种画风感觉还是好些的,虽然都是远古时代的。今天题目感觉难度适中,但是太过于偏向动态规划了吧。。。还有搜索傻逼题乱入。 2、Sort 产品排序 大概题意:给出n个产品,每个产品有加工时间和冷却时间。现有两台加工机,每台加工机同一时间只能加工一个产品。产品加工完后就进入冷却
阅读全文
摘要:1、前言 后来做了一遍觉得今天题目200还是很轻松的吧,数据感觉比较水。为什么说后来做,因为考试的时候快2个多小时了结果突然系统报错然后什么修改都没了,然后直接弃考了。这是不是也要算个问题? 2、Child 幼儿园 大概题意:给出一个长度为n的带权环,要求从中某处切开,顺时针平铺形成一个数组,通过最
阅读全文
摘要:1、前言 最近考试的一句话总结:能不考跪的时候就跪了,能虐场的时候就不去虐了。没错我昨天才写完的最近考试的一些特别傻的错误,然而今天又新增了一个,等会再讲,真是太(sang)开(xin)心(bing)了(kuang)。 2、Dis 最大跨距 大概题意:给出三个字符串a,b1,b2,要求b1和b2出现
阅读全文
摘要:1、前言 说是说题解+总结,但是其实这就是依次对最近考试的一个自我总结,并没有什么题解,因为最近的考试都没有提供官方题解,所以我也不能自以为是地去进行分析。最近的考试。。。很令人无语。现在来总结一下考试的各种抽风吧。 2、数组开小 这个感觉以前没怎么出现过?可最近已经出现过几次了。。。但是不是那种写
阅读全文
摘要:1、前言 不能这么坑啊!这题目一久远了数据就开始各种坑,谁都不知道有坑但是就我掉进了坑。我还能说什么。 2、Beatle 甲壳先生最新版 大概题意:两个问题:给出一张n*m网格图,求从左下角到右上角直走要经过多少个网格;给出k,求有多少个组(x,y),满足在x*y网格图中直走要经过k个网格。 总结:
阅读全文
摘要:1、前言 今天在从来没用过的新机房里面考的,感觉不习惯的地方好多。首先这个地方只有Emacs,虽然我还是会用的,但是多少有点不习惯了。后来发现在Windows下无法调试,只能临时去网上下Dev了。哎哎哎。 2、Number3 又见拆分数 大概题意:将一个整数n拆分成若干个数,要求每个数出现次数不超过
阅读全文
摘要:1、前言 今天AC了一道神题,应该说神一般的AC了一道题。我自己都不清楚这就是正解,还有前人给他附上了一个高端的名词——欧拉公式。显然有一种歪打正着的感觉。 2、暴力摩托 大概题意:给出一张无向图,每次给出起点和终点,要求从起点到终点的路的权值最大与最小之差最小。 总结:做过很多次了,最小生成树的一
阅读全文
摘要:1、前言 栗师大爷的题目就是神。看了金凯的解题报告感觉更加神了。 2、寻找矩形 大概题意:在平面直角坐标系上有n个点,求这些点能够组成多少个矩形。 总结:虽说这是水题,但是依旧可以一题多解。首先最简单的,O(n^2)寻找矩形对角两个点,然后判断另外两个对角是否存在点,需要开一个10000^2的数组存
阅读全文
摘要:Description 给一个数字串s和正整数d, 统计s有多少种不同的排列能被d整除(可以有前导0)。例如123434有90种排列能被2整除,其中末位为2的有30种,末位为4的有60种。 给一个数字串s和正整数d, 统计s有多少种不同的排列能被d整除(可以有前导0)。例如123434有90种排列能
阅读全文
摘要:1、20150919 <1> 购物 大概题意:你手上有n种面值的硬币,每种无限个,你希望带尽量少的硬币,但能够组成1-x之间的任意值。 题解:DP/贪心。 <2> 养猪 大概题意:有n个数,每次你可以选择一个数,选择完之后,第i个数会减少p[i](如果已经<=0,则记为0)。求每次选择数的总和。 总
阅读全文
摘要:1、前言 迎接NOIP的到来。。。在这段闲暇时间,决定刷刷水题。这里只是作非常简单的一些总结。 2、NOIP2014 <1> 生活大爆炸之石头剪刀布(模拟) 这是一道考你会不会编程的题目。。。方法有很多,预处理输赢矩阵,或者一大堆if什么的乱搞就行了。 <2> 联合权值(搜索) 简单的树上求解问题,
阅读全文
摘要:1、前言 我总算是有点心情来写写总结了。其实这样也不好。。。貌似总结没考好的才更重要,但是我自认为那都是因为一些七七八八的原因导致的。。。不过话说回来差距还是很大的。这几天已经考了很多次NOIP模拟题,说是模拟题,但其实每一天的难度变化都比较大,有些知识点也明显地涉及到了省选难度。今天感觉是难度比较
阅读全文
摘要:1、前言 暴力了一上午。除了第三题暴力存在着莫名的优越之外没什么好讲的(也就多10分,不要问我为什么)。 2、Seq 拓扑序列 大概题意:略(我觉得我越来越懒了 =。=) 总结:其实这道题如果你对卡特兰数有点印象的话就会一下子发现了。。。但是今天尴尬的地方就在于我知道这是卡特兰数之后却无能为力,因为
阅读全文
摘要:1、前言 考得稀下的,算了不说了。 2、Password 博士的密码 大概题意:给出一个数列,选出其中一些数字使其和为所给数字。 总结:被这道题坑死了!为了省时间,我事先排了序并且用了前缀和优化,但是它的数列存在负数,而且是所有数据都有负数,所以直接爆零无话可说。后来再看了一眼题目发现好像确确实实没
阅读全文
摘要:1、前言 考得真是萎。但是我也没办法啊,这确实是想不到Prim算法好不好。。。感觉这题目还是挺神的。今天是图论专题,但是有种很明显的感觉,暴力实在不好打。 2、Test 最优检测 大概题意:有一个长度为n的0-1数列,但你并不知道是多少。你可以花费c[i][j]的代价得到[i,j]在mod 2意义下
阅读全文
摘要:1、前言 今天是APIO2010的题目,主要目的依旧是练习搜索(当然说是这么说)。感觉总体而言还是可做的,前两道似乎都比较适合骗分。 2、Commando 特别行动队 大概题意:给出一个序列,请划分成若干个子段,要求每一个子段和x变换为ax^2+bx+c后的总和最大。(a,b,c均已知,a<0) 总
阅读全文
摘要:1、前言 同样是搜索题,感觉今天的鬼畜多了,还出现了一道标程都莫名其妙的题目。。。 2、Maze 迷宫 大概题意:在一个0-1矩阵中给出起始点和终点,求最短路径。(0为可走,1为不可走) 总结:边界条件出了问题导致WA+RE了20分。我们可以把外围所有点设置为1(不可走),也可以在搜索时添加判断。还
阅读全文